Understanding Signal's Core Security Ethos
Signal stands as a foremost privacy-centric communication tools worldwide. Developed through privacy experts, this service prioritizes complete encryption which is the default configuration, ensuring that communications remain unreadable to outsiders including cybercriminals, marketers, or governments. This methodology successfully eliminates weaknesses common among traditional chat apps, where information could get retained within servers.
Signal's architecture utilizes an open-source encryption framework, which has passed thorough independent audits. Such openness builds trust within subscribers concerned regarding online surveillance. Additionally, unlike numerous popular services, Signal gathers scant user metadata, thereby limiting exposure to data breaches. Consequently, it remains the leading choice among advocates, journalists, along with privacy-conscious individuals.
The Way Signal's Encryption Mechanism Functions
Within the core of Signal lies advanced full cryptography, which enciphers messages exclusively within the devices participating during a conversation. This means that even Signal's servers cannot decrypt the transmitted texts, voice communications, and documents. The security keys remain exclusively generated and held on-device, averting illegitimate decryption by outside entities. Such robust safeguarding extends to multi-participant chats, video calls, as well as media transfers.
The application employs perfect forward secrecy, a attribute that alters cipher codes after each message, making historical interactions unreadable even a phone becomes compromised. Additionally, users can manually verify contacts using security numbers, adding an extra verification layer to counter interception threats. Such preventive measures collectively establish an nearly impenetrable security framework, exceeding numerous industry standards.
Data Features Above Encoding
Signal supplements its security with innovative privacy utilities like disappearing messages, which systematically delete after a set duration ranging from five seconds and 7 days. The option mitigates long-term data storage risks, especially for sensitive exchanges. Similarly noteworthy are the display protection capability, that prevents thumbnails from messages appearing on device lock-screens, adding a extra tangible security barrier.
Regarding heightened identity protection, Signal allows individuals to sign up with just their phone number, and avoids connecting email addresses and social identities. Also, it supports private keyboard settings, disabling external keyboard tracking in order to prevent data harvesting. Subscribers may furthermore enable account verification with PINs, deterring unwanted profile transfers. Collectively, these features appeal to users demanding all-encompassing online secrecy.
The App Compared With Conventional Messengers
When contrasted against popular messengers like WhatsApp and Facebook messenger, Signal repeatedly demonstrates superior privacy safeguards. Unlike many competitors, it neither profits from subscriber data nor incorporates targeted advertising, maintaining genuine impartiality. Furthermore, while services including Telegram offer E2E encoding exclusively in "private" chats, Signal enforces it globally throughout all communications, including collective conversations as well as media sharing.
Another critical difference lies with metadata collection: apps such as iMessage retain significant user information within corporate servers, while Signal keeps virtually none beyond account registration timestamps. Such restrained approach drastically lowers vulnerability toward state subpoenas and data leaks. Consequently, for security advocates, Signal embodies the gold standard, free of commercial tracking motives.

Extending Access Across Multiple Gadgets
The service supports seamless cross-device integration, allowing subscribers to operate the app concurrently across smartphones, pads, as well as computers. For use the Signal电脑版, users should download the dedicated PC client from the official website or trusted repositories. Thereafter, linking devices involves scanning a QR code displayed within the computer monitor with your phone application, establishing an secure pairing without sharing message content to servers.
Such linkage preserves end-to-end security between every connected devices, with messages updated in real-time. However, some functions like disappearing messages and recipient authentication require manual configuration for every device. Importantly, tablet compatibility currently necessitates linking with an existing mobile account, whereas desktop versions operate autonomously after paired. This flexibility empowers workers as well as security advocates to sustain protected exchanges throughout multiple digital environments.
Open-Source Framework plus Public Trust
The app's codebase remains fully publicly accessible, permitting global developers to inspect, alter, and validate the security claims. Such extreme transparency differentiates it against closed options, in which vulnerabilities might remain undetected for extended times. External security assessments conducted through reputable organizations like Trail of Bits repeatedly affirm its protocol integrity, strengthening broad trust among academics, technologists, along with civil liberties groups.
Moreover, Signal functions as a non-profit entity (Signal Foundation), funded largely through grants from benefactors like WhatsApp's co-founder. This revenue model eliminates incentives for weaken privacy in exchange of profit, aligning with its user-first mission. Transparency documents published periodically outline authority information requests as well as compliance statistics, most of end in minimal disclosure due to minimal retained subscriber logs. Such responsibility cements Signal's reputation as the dependable guardian for digital freedoms.
Advanced Privacy Settings by Experts
Seasoned users may exploit Signal's granular privacy controls to further harden protection. Features include proxy calling support, which masks participants' IP addresses through directing connections via Signal infrastructure, thereby obscuring physical locations from contact recipients. Likewise, constant display locks prevent message snippets from compromised devices, while fingerprint verification adds a level for device access security.
Regarding groups managing sensitive dialogues, Signal offers moderator controls to limit invitations permissions and reset group join URLs periodically to prevent unauthorized access. Users may furthermore personally approve every incoming collective participant or enable "consent-required" messaging in order to restrict spam. Additionally, periodic safety number verifications alert users if a security key alters, signaling potential compromise attempts. Such enterprise-grade tools appeal to corporate and high-risk user groups.
